A rare case of anterior shoulder dislocation in 1-year- and 10-month-old toddler: case report and literature review.

Giacomo Maso1, Elisa Pala2, Antonio Berizzi2, Pietro Ruggieri2.   

Abstract

We report our clinical experience of a 1 year and 10 month child with traumatic anterior shoulder dislocation who underwent non-operative reduction and Desault's bandage immobilization for 10 days. No associated fractures were found and after bandage removal, full ROM of the shoulder was immediately assessed. Further research is needed to unified guideline of treatment and the time of immobilization for this type of injury in pediatric population.
